About

Joanne Phillips is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Clinical Psychology and Obstetrics and Gynec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Joanne Phillips has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 356 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 6 papers in Clinical Psychology and 4 papers in Obstetrics and Gynecology. Recurrent topics in Joanne Phillips’s work include Maternal Mental Health During Pregnancy and Postpartum (4 papers), Eating Disorders and Behaviors (2 papers) and Chemotherapy-induced organ toxicity mitigation (2 papers). Joanne Phillips is often cited by papers focused on Maternal Mental Health During Pregnancy and Postpartum (4 papers), Eating Disorders and Behaviors (2 papers) and Chemotherapy-induced organ toxicity mitigation (2 papers). Joanne Phillips coll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and United Kingdom. Joanne Phillips's co-authors include Helen Skouteris, Ross King, Madeline Joseph, Sarah K. England, Elaine Gadd, C. Dean, Stephen Matthey, B. Barnett, David S. Alberts and Denise J. Roe and has published in prestigious journals such as J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ute, Journal of Intellectual Disability Research and British Journal of Health Psychology.
